Comment: Here is the background information about my problem. It was caused when I downloaded new drivers for my motherboard which included a new IDE device. Once I started up for the first time after my installation the computer seemed to freeze. I noticed it was reading one of my two cd drives for ages. Once I ejected the disk the black screen went away and the computer started. Same thing happens on the desktop, it freezes me up till I eject the cd. In my other cd drive the cd showed up under my computer within seconds and didn't freeze my desktop up. Can soemone please tell me what is happening? Reply: I had the same problem and never found a solution. If it helps i found that it only happened with certain brands of media and so i had to switch to different discs. Also i found that if a disc was even slightly dirty this would occur. Some drives are very prone to losing their place on the disc if it is a little dusty.
